During the Age of Enlightenment, the concept of natural human rights as we know it started to emerge. The thinkers of this age were the first to question the authority of the absolute monarch. The idea that kings have all the rights shifted in favor of the idea people have their own rights, gained by birth.
<u>Natural human rights included rights to life, liberty, and property</u>. By their ideas, <u>the government was the one who should ensure all people have these rights</u>. They are universal, despite the beliefs or the government that holds the law. In case these universal rights are not fulfilled, people have all the right to overthrown the government that has not provided them.
Docetist are religious group of
people following the doctrine of Docetism (Dokētaí=illusionists), based on the
phenomenon on Christ being both human and God. This particular doctrine denies
Christ’s historical and bodily existence and claims it to be an illusion.
Therefore, Docetist say that Christ didn’t repay for sins as he wasn’t even
alive. Action and beliefs of Docetist have arisen concern over the figurative
or literal meaning of sentence “The World was made of Flesh” (Gospel of Jon).
